Cardamom Extract Clinical trial on Covid patients

A Prospective, Open Label, Randomized, Controlled, Pilot Clinical Study To Evaluate The Safety And Efficacy Of Cardamom Extract In Mild To Modrate Covid-19 Adult Patients

Conditions

Health Condition 1: - Health Condition 2: B972- Coronavirus as the cause of diseases classified elsewhere

Interventions

Intervention1: Cardamom extract: Dose:200 mg Dosage form: Capsule Duration: Day 0 to Day 7 Frequency : 3 times daily orally after meal Control Intervention1: NIL standard of care recommended by GOVt

Eligibility

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Subjects aged 18-65 years of age and of either sex 2. Subjects who are willing to give consent to the study 3. COVID-19 positive clinical symptoms and (subsequently) confirmed by the current recommended confirmatory test (RT-PCR). 4. Mild to Moderate disease (NEWS score Less than/equal to 8) 5. Can take oral medicines 6. Subject willing to abide by and comply with the study protocol.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Age less than 18 years and more than 65 years 2. Pregnancy and lactation 3. Severe or complicated course of COVID-19 disease 4. Presence of acute hypoxic respiratory failure/ need for Intensive care unit (ICU) stay/ Patients who need mechanical ventilation. 5. Any uncontrolled systemic disease, infection 6. Those with serious Cardiovascular, Cerebrovascular, Respiratory, Liver or Renal disease or any other disorder. 7. Other conditions, which in the opinion of the investigators makes the patient unsuitable for enrolment or could interfere in adherence to of the study protocol

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
â?¢ Change in Chest CT severity score (CO-RADS) from baseline to day 7 â?¢ Change in Viral load from baseline to day 7 â?¢ Change in immune markers (IL-6, LDH, TNF, TLC, ALC, FERRITIN, CRP and D-DIMER) from baseline to day 7 Timepoint: Day 0 and Day 7

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
â?¢ Change in National Early Warning Score (NEWS) from baseline to day 7 â?¢ Change in clinical symptoms on 5 point ordinal scale from baseline to day 7 â?¢ Number of patients tested COVID 19 RT-PCR negative at day 7 â?¢ Number of patients requiring intensive care treatment (ICU) at day 7 â?¢ Number of patients requiring Ventilator support at day 7 Timepoint: Day 0 and Day 7
